Output 50a0a856d807826b1e27c14fc34110d966765511ec8526e115bd1b5405ee76ac:0

value
806590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c76c68514a6c0ed04052e32e119109f786e6c553 OP_EQUAL
address
3KsUG16dUt1boMzt4CF4hxFCLpx8nHq5q5
transaction
50a0a856d807826b1e27c14fc34110d966765511ec8526e115bd1b5405ee76ac
confirmations
123780
spent
true